Frequently Asked Questions about Hallandale Beach
What type of rentals are currently available in Hallandale Beach?
There are currently 1713 Apartments for Rent in Hallandale Beach,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,150 to $30,500. There are also 1956 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Hallandale Beach ranging from $900 to $70,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Hallandale Beach?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Hallandale Beach ranges from $900 to $70,000 with an average monthly rent of $17,408.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Hallandale Beach?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Hallandale Beach range from $1,940 to $30,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,950 to $25,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,990 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,500.
